The following weapons were used in the film Black Hawk Down:

Black hawk down ver1.jpg




Colt M733

Busch (Richard Tyson) is the first Delta member on screen, and also the first soldier we see carrying a version of the Black Rifle, a Colt Commando M733. All Delta members carry an M733. Master Sgt. Gary Gordon (Nikolaj Coster Waldau) can be seen carrying one featuring a camouflage paint scheme and a silencer, which is then used by Chief Warrant Officer Michael Durant (Ron Eldard) to pick off several more Somalis before running out of ammunition and being overwhelmed.

M60 Machine Gun

Specialist Shawn Nelson (Ewen Bremner) can be seen carrying an M60 machine gun as his standard weapon.

M60 in 7.62x51mm NATO
Nelson with his M60.
Nelson fires his M60.

M249 SAW

Several Rangers can be seen carrying M249 SAWs throughout the film. It is also the weapon used by Specialist Lance Twombly (Tom Hardy) to accidentally deafen Nelson when he fires it too close to his head.

RPG-7

The Russian manufactured RPG-7 features prominently in the film as it is the weapon which brings down a pair of Black Hawks. In one scene, a projectile from an RPG-7 strikes the driver of one of the deuce and a half trucks in Lt. Colonel Danny McKnight (Tom Sizemore)'s convoy and fails to detonate, impaling the luckless soldier instead.

M1911A1

We see the M1911A1 pistol in the hands of both Delta operators and a Somali militiaman. As the two Delta snipers attempt to secure the second crash site they are forced to draw their sidearms, M1911A1 and Beretta M9 pistols, as the overwhelming Somali forces close in on them. Another Delta operator can be seen practicing with an M1911A1 near the beginning of the film.

Browning M2

The Browning M2 heavy machine gun is fielded by both the US Army HMMWVs, the UN APCs, and the Somali militia in the film. The opening shots of the film feature Somali militiamen slaughtering a gathered crowd at a food distribution center with the powerful fifty-cal.

GE M134 Minigun

During the slaughter of the crowd, The U.S. forces hovering in the MH-60 aren't cleared to fire the GE M134 Miniguns mounted on their Black Hawk. Pylon-mounted miniguns are also carried by the AH-6 Little Birds and rain lead in several scenes.

M67 Hand Grenade

While loading up for the assault on the Olympic Hotel Sanderson (William Fichtner) picks up M67 fragmentation hand grenades. He is also seen throwing one into a window to take out a Somali who has him and the Deltas and Rangers pinned down.
